Label Description
Interface Name
Name of the router interface.
Arp Populate
Specifies whether or not ARP populate is enabled.
Used/Provided
Used — The number of lease-states that are currently in use on a spe-
cific interface, that is, the number of clients on that interface got an IP
address by DHCP. This value is always less than or equal to the ‘Pro-
vided’ field.
Provided — The lease-populate value that is configured for a spe-
cific interface.
Info Option
Indicates whether Option 82 processing is enabled on the interface.
Admin State
Indicates the administrative state.
